Common Challenges and Roadblocks in Fire Academy Training

Fire academy training is a rigorous and demanding program that requires students to push themselves to their physical and mental limits. While the rewards of becoming a firefighter are numerous, the challenges and roadblocks that students may face during training can be significant. In this article, we will discuss some of the most common challenges and roadblocks that students may encounter, and provide examples of how these challenges can be overcome.

Physical and Mental Demands

Fire academy training is known for its high level of physical and mental demands. Students are required to perform physically demanding tasks such as climbing stairs, carrying heavy equipment, and battling fires in hot and smoky environments. They must also be mentally prepared to deal with high-stress situations, such as emergency calls and rescues. To overcome these challenges, students should focus on building their strength, endurance, and mental toughness through regular exercise and training.

  • Physical Conditioning: Regular exercise, such as cardio and strength training, can help students build the physical strength and endurance needed to perform the demands of fire academy training.
  • Mental Preparation: Techniques such as meditation and deep breathing can help students manage stress and stay focused under pressure.
  • Teamwork: Building good relationships with fellow students and instructors can help students stay motivated and supported throughout the training process.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are the essential skills required to be successful in a fire academy program?

Skills such as first aid and emergency medical procedures, equipment operation and maintenance, and communication and teamwork are all crucial for a successful career in firefighting.

How do I know which type of fire academy is right for me?

Consider factors such as your career goals, personal interests, and availability of programs in your area to determine the best fit for you.

Are there any funding options available to support fire academy students?

Yes, various scholarships, grants, and veteran benefits are available to support students pursuing fire academy programs.

What is fire academy accreditation, and why is it important?

FIRE ACADEMY accreditation ensures that a program meets certain standards and guidelines, providing students with a quality education and increasing their chances of success in the firefighting field.

What are some of the most common challenges faced by fire academy students?

Students may face physical and mental challenges, as well as difficulties with equipment operation and communication, but with the right mindset and support, these challenges can be overcome.

How do I choose the right fire academy near me?

Research programs, talk to current students and instructors, and weigh the pros and cons of each academy to make an informed decision.
